Abstract :
Enterprise computing services play a critical role in universities enabling faculty, students, and staff to complete meaningful work and further goals of the institution. These services require physical server computers with processors, disk space, and memory. Physical servers take up data center space and consume power; they are designed for performance with little detail paid to ecological design. In an effort to reduce hardware and maintenance costs, a trend to virtualize these servers exists, which would also free up physical space and save energy. This exploratory case study explored the current sustainable computing trends at a large university in the Midwest as well as whether practices of virtualizing enterprise server computers were economically, socially, and ecologically sustainable. Finally, this study investigated how these practices were planned, monitored, and evaluated. Findings indicate virtualizing enterprise servers in the Intelligent Infrastructure is economically, socially, and environmentally sustainability. Recommendations for university leadership were developed as a result of data gathering and analysis from participant interviews, correspondence, observations and artifacts. Maximizing utility and outreach were the two dominant related themes present in the data sources.
